We enrolled our 6-year-old in the Extreme TaeKwon MaDang program in Calgary, and overall, it was a positive experience. The instructors, like Coach Sam, were very engaging and made sure each child was involved, which really helped my son feel confident. He learned some cool kicks and even got to practice a few flips, which he loved. However, I did find that pickup could get a bit chaotic at times. There were long lines, and it seemed like some parents weren’t as attentive as they should be, which made it a little stressful. Still, the small class sizes kept things manageable, and my son made a friend during the sessions, which was great. I appreciate that the environment is inclusive, catering to kids of various skill levels. Overall, I’d recommend it, but I'd suggest arriving a bit earlier for pickup to avoid the rush.

My daughter has been attending Extreme TaeKwon MaDang in Calgary for the past few months, and overall, it has been a positive experience. We enrolled her in the Little Heroes class, and she absolutely loved learning dynamic kicks and flips. The instructor, Jason, is fantastic with the kids, making sure that everyone participates and feels included. I appreciate the small group size, which allows for more personal attention. One minor annoyance was the long lines during pickup; it can get a bit chaotic, especially with kids excitedly running out. However, once we got past that, it was nice to see my daughter so engaged and making friends in the process. If your child is active and enjoys trying new things, I'd recommend checking out this program.
